Clinker Sampling on Deep Pan Conveyor (DPC) - Elephant Trunk Type
Overview
The HSC Sampler (Elephant Trunk Type) extracts representative samples of hot clinker directly from Deep Pan Conveyor (DPC) systems, enabling immediate verification of kiln performance and clinker quality. This stage involves maximum temperature, high abrasion, and continuous flow.
Process Role
The DPC stage is the first point where clinker leaves the kiln system and enters material handling equipment. Without sampling at this stage, plants lose real-time visibility into kiln output, delaying corrective action.
Engineering Principle
Pivoting full-stream interception using an "elephant trunk" cutter mechanism. The controlled swing motion passes through the clinker stream for full stream interception during each sampling cycle.
Core Engineering Features
Thermal Shock-Resistant Construction
Components designed to withstand rapid temperature variations without structural degradation.
Abrasion-Resistant Sampling Components
Wear-resistant materials ensure long service life under continuous exposure to hot clinker.
Continuous-Duty Operation
Engineered for uninterrupted operation in high-capacity clinker handling systems.
Pivoting Cutter Mechanism
Swing-arm design enables full stream interception while maintaining mechanical stability.
